Recent evidence suggests that a specific MAP kinase pathway involving the MAP kinase kinase kinase TAK 1 and the MAP kinase NLK counteract Wnt signalling . ^^^ In particular , homologues of TAK 1 and NLK , MOM 4 and LIT 1 , negatively regulate Wnt controlled cell fate decision in the early Caenorhabditis elegans embryo . ^^^ Moreover , TAK 1 activates NLK , which phosphorylates TCFs bound to ( beta ) catenin . ^^^ In addition , alterations in TAK 1 NLK might play a role in cancer . . ^^^ |

The TAK 1 NLK mitogen activated protein kinase cascade functions in the Wnt 5a / Ca ( 2+ ) pathway to antagonize Wnt / beta catenin signaling . ^^^ The mitogen activated protein kinase ( MAPK ) pathway composed of TAK 1 MAPK kinase kinase and NLK MAPK also negatively regulates the canonical Wnt / beta catenin signaling pathway . ^^^ Here we show that activation of CaMKII induces stimulation of the TAK 1 NLK pathway . ^^^ Overexpression of Wnt 5a in HEK 293 cells activates NLK through TAK 1 . ^^^ Furthermore , by using a chimeric receptor ( beta ( 2 ) AR Rfz 2 ) containing the ligand binding and transmembrane segments from the beta ( 2 ) adrenergic receptor ( beta ( 2 ) AR ) and the cytoplasmic domains from rat Frizzled 2 ( Rfz 2 ) , stimulation with the beta adrenergic agonist isoproterenol activates activities of endogenous CaMKII , TAK 1 , and NLK and inhibits beta catenin induced transcriptional activation . ^^^ |

Role of the TAK 1 NLK STAT 3 pathway in TGF beta mediated mesoderm induction . ^^^ Transforming growth factor ( TGF ) beta activated kinase 1 ( TAK 1 ) and Nemo like kinase ( NLK ) function in Xenopus , Drosophila , and Caenorhabditis elegans development . ^^^ Here we report that serine phosphorylation of STAT 3 induced by TAK 1 NLK cascade is essential fo TGF beta mediated mesoderm induction in Xenopus embryo . ^^^ Depletion of TAK 1 , NLK , or STAT 3 blocks TGF beta mediated mesoderm induction . ^^^ Moreover , depletion of either TAK 1 or NLK inhibits endogenous serine phosphorylation of STAT 3 . ^^^ |

Wnt 1 signal induces phosphorylation and degradation of c Myb protein via TAK 1 , HIPK 2 , and NLK . ^^^ Here we report that c Myb protein is phosphorylated and degraded by Wnt 1 signal via the pathway involving TAK 1 ( TGF beta activated kinase ) , HIPK 2 ( homeodomain interacting protein kinase 2 ) , and NLK ( Nemo like kinase ) . ^^^ Wnt 1 signal causes the nuclear entry of TAK 1 , which then activates HIPK 2 and the mitogen activated protein ( MAP ) kinase like kinase NLK . ^^^ |
